Senior Software Developer - State Street International (Ireland) Ltd
  • Dublin, Leinster, Ireland
  • via BeBee.com
-
Job Description

Principal Software Engineer

We are seeking a highly skilled and motivated engineer to participate in one or more Charles River IMS modules or components of an Agile scrum team.

The team you will be joining is a part of Charles River Development (CRD), which became a part of State Street in 2018. CRD helps create enterprise investment management software solutions for large institutions in the areas of institutional investment, wealth management, and hedge funds.

Key Responsibilities:

  • Influence and impact the architecture, standards, and design of key product initiatives for applications in Java services.
  • Contribute as a Sr. Individual contributor within a team of top engineers.
  • Work in a dynamic, fast-paced Agile scrum team environment.

Requirements:

  • Excellent problem-solving ability.
  • Smart, dedicated, collaborative people with motivation and desire to learn/grow while contributing ideas to the overall success of the team's objectives.
  • Ability to work independently, handle multiple tasks simultaneously, and adapt quickly to changes.
  • Extensive Java n-tier application experience (emphasis on back-end development, core Java, and multi-threading preferred).
  • Strong SQL skills with considerable experience with an RDBMS like Oracle or SQL Server.
  • Strong with OO design and development.
  • Hands-on experience with Web Services.

About State Street:

State Street is one of the largest custodian banks, asset managers, and asset intelligence companies in the world. From technology to product innovation, we're making our mark on the financial services industry.

We provide investment servicing, data & analytics, investments research & trading, and investment management to institutional clients.

What We Offer:

  • Competitive and comprehensive benefits packages.
  • Flexible Work Program to help match your needs.
  • Access to development programs and educational support to help you reach your full potential.
  • Inclusion, diversity, and social responsibility.
  • Tools to help balance your professional and personal life.

;